If the sum of first m terms of an AP is the same as the sum of its first n terms, show that the sum of its first (m+n) terms is zero.  

Answer»

Sm = Sn⇒ m/2 [2a+(m-1)d] = n/2 [2a +(n -1)d]

⇒ 2a(m -n) + d(m2 -m -n2 + n) = 0

⇒ (m -n) [2a +(m+n -1) d] = 0 or Sm+n = 0
